Global Accessories, Inc. recently announced the availability of WHI's Nexpart Virtual Inventory to its customers. The company, which manufactures soft products and accessories for the aftermarket, will make Virtual Inventory accessible to customers using Nexpart eCommerce Web sites, thereby creating online availability of parts that are out-of-stock at their customers' locations.

"Virtual Inventory is a service we provide to our customers to help make them the first and best choice for their customers," says Robert Castle, the company's executive vice president and CIO. "Providing our customers and their customers the ability to check price and availability real time and order from our DC's from their Nexpart eCommerce solution will allow them to capture sales that they're missing today."

Stan Gowisnock, WHI's executive vice president of sales and marketing adds, "Global Accessories is a company that understands how to use technology to create competitive advantage. Making their DC inventory available online to their customers as well as more than 61,000 Nexpart eCommerce users is another powerful reason to do business with Global Accessories. Integrating the supply chain between manufacturers, distributors and their customers is critical to the long term profitability for the aftermarket, and Nexpart Virtual Inventory makes that a reality."
